FIRST (For Inspiration and Recognition of Science and Technology) is a global nonprofit organization, not a for-profit company, that runs youth robotics programs to inspire STEM interest among students aged 5-18.[3][1][2] Its flagship FIRST Robotics Competition (FRC) challenges high school teams (grades 9-12) to design, build, and program industrial-sized robots in six weeks, competing in sports-like games while developing skills like teamwork, fundraising, and engineering.[4][1][5] FIRST's mission is to prepare young people for the future by building confidence, resilience, and STEM proficiency through "Coopertition" (collaboration and competition), with proven impacts on career interest, especially among underrepresented groups in science and technology.[3][2]
The organization oversees a progression of programs: FIRST LEGO League Junior (K-4), FIRST LEGO League (grades 4-8), FIRST Tech Challenge (grades 7-12), and FRC, fostering a pathway from early play to advanced robotics.[1][2] FIRST emphasizes life skills beyond robots, hosting thousands of teams worldwide—growing from 28 in 1989 to over 2,850 by 2014, with continued expansion post-COVID.[5][2]
FIRST was founded in 1989 by inventor and entrepreneur Dean Kamen and MIT professor emeritus Woodie Flowers, driven by Kamen's concern over low STEM participation, particularly among women and minorities.[1][2][3] Kamen, inspired by sports' excitement, envisioned robotics competitions blending competition with engineering to spark enthusiasm.[2] The first FRC season launched in 1992, starting with 28 teams and evolving into an international event with regional qualifiers leading to a championship.[5][2]
Key milestones include rapid growth, a "More Than Robots" ethos emphasizing holistic development, and post-pandemic recovery, with over 600 teams at the 2024 Championship.[2][3] Flowers provided academic rigor, while Kamen's entrepreneurial vision scaled it into a nonprofit serving millions, now a 501(c)(3) with top fiscal responsibility rankings.[3][5]
FIRST rides the STEM education and talent pipeline trend, addressing global shortages in engineering/tech skills amid AI, automation, and robotics booms.[3][2] Its timing aligns with rising demand for diverse STEM talent—over 90% of teams/mentors retain yearly involvement, boosting long-term interest.[5] Market forces like corporate sponsorships (needing $150K-$200K per regional) and volunteer networks amplify reach, influencing ecosystems by producing skilled graduates for tech firms.[5][3]
FIRST shapes culture by celebrating science, with alumni entering robotics/engineering fields, and expands via international events, countering demographic gaps in STEM.[2][3] It influences startups indirectly through inspired innovators and partnerships, embedding "Gracious Professionalism" as a tech community value.[4]
